&lt;p&gt;In an interview with TV station WTSP, Tampa Bay Buccanneers quarterback &lt;a href=&quot;http://sports.espn.go.com/nfl/players/profile?playerId=2026&quot;&gt;Jeff Garcia&lt;/a&gt; did not hold back in his feelings towards recently-fired head coach Jon Gruden, as reported by the &lt;a href=&quot;http://blogs.tampabay.com/bucs/2009/01/jeff-garcia-buc.html&quot;&gt;St. Petersburg Times&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&quot;I know for me personally, going through that with him was a very difficult time, disappointing time. But the one thing that I always tried to look back on or reflect on was that I wasn't the first and I won't be the last. If it continues to be this way with players, it is going to get to a point where somebody who is above or in control will say 'Enough is enough.' I think that's what it got to. There are players who were here in the past before I got here who had their own experiences of how they were treated or how they were misled. For the two years that I was here, I enjoyed my experiences on the field with coach Gruden but there were some things that obviously rubbed me wrong and I'm sure they were not easy to deal with. But I'm just one guy. Whatever the reason was that they made the change, they felt it was time to make the change.&quot;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Garcia, who will be a free agent in March, also told the station that he does have interest in remaining with the team under a new coaching staff led by Raheem Morris. &quot;I am open to listening if they want to talk. That's what it's basically going to come down to. It's really not in my court. The ball's not in my court - it's in theirs.&quot;&lt;/p&gt;
